FRONTAL LOBE
|
Located in
front of the central sulcus. | |
|
Concerned with
reasoning, planning, parts of speech and movement (motor cortex), emotions, and
problem-solving. |
TEMPORAL LOBE
|
Located below the lateral fissure. | |
|
Concerned with perception and
recognition of auditory stimuli (hearing) and memory (hippocampus). |
PARIETAL LOBE
|
Located behind
the central sulcus. | |
|
Concerned with perception of
stimuli related to touch, pressure, temperature and pain. |
